About 6c

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

6c is a mid-terrace house in Gillingham (ME7 1BB). It has a recorded floor area of 107 m² (around 1152 sq ft) and construction records dating it to 1900-1929. The latest certificate (November 2017) shows an E (score 52),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would push it to D (score 64).

At 107 m² the property is well over the postcode median (56 m² across 9 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 78% of similar EPCs). 9 years since the last transfer (December 2016). 5 planning records sit against the property, 3 approved, 2 refused. Across 2003–2016, sale prices on this property compounded at 7.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£253,000 is 31.8% above the 2016 sale price.
